Hi, we recently moved and as we've tried to get our printed to connect to our new wifi network we are getting nowhere. We have the HP 2600 desk jet series. No touch screen. HP Smart cannot find the printer. How do I add this printer to my computer?

Thank you for posting back.
Let's prepare your printer for a wireless connection, and restart the printer, computer, and router.
- Turn the printer off, and then wait 10 seconds.
- Disconnect the printer power cord from the printer.
- Turn off the computer or the device you are trying to print from.
- Connect the printer power cord to the printer, and then turn on the printer.
- Disconnect the power cord from your wireless router, and then wait 10 seconds.
- Reconnect the power cord to the router. Wait until Internet service is restored. Internet service is interrupted while the router is off.
- Turn on the computer.
And, also ensure you connect the printer to the 2.4ghz type.

Let's restore network settings to default settings:
Press and hold the Wireless button and the Cancel button X from the printer control panel together for three seconds.
